909852-21-7,909852-27-3,909852-33-1,705937-30-0,508210-83-1,105448-29-1 Supplier | CHEMPROVIDER.COM
CMO CDMO service. CHEMPROVIDER.COM supply 909852-21-7,909852-27-3,909852-33-1,705937-30-0,508210-83-1,105448-29-1 and related compounds.
105448-29-1 909852-27-3 909852-21-7 508210-83-1 705937-30-0 909852-33-1